Skip to content

Which Nut is Good in Protein? A Guide to High-Protein Nuts

3 min read

According to the USDA, peanuts, while technically a legume, contain more protein per serving than any other commonly consumed nut, boasting over 7 grams per ounce. When considering nuts for a protein boost, it is crucial to look beyond just the grams per serving and examine the overall nutritional profile.

Quick Summary

An overview of nuts and their varying protein content. Highlights top contenders like peanuts, almonds, and pistachios, detailing their nutritional benefits and how they can be incorporated into a balanced diet.

Key Points

  • Peanuts lead the pack: While technically a legume, peanuts consistently offer the highest protein content per ounce among common nuts.

  • Pistachios are a complete protein: Unlike many plant-based proteins, pistachios contain all nine essential amino acids, making them a complete protein source.

  • Almonds are rich in antioxidants: Besides a high protein count, almonds are packed with antioxidants, especially in their skin, and are a great source of vitamin E.

  • Consider variety for diverse nutrients: Different nuts offer unique benefits, such as the omega-3s in walnuts and selenium in Brazil nuts, so consuming a variety is best.

  • Portion control is key: Nuts are energy-dense, so eating them in moderation, typically a handful or one ounce, helps you gain the benefits without excessive calories.

  • Versatile for any meal: High-protein nuts can be easily incorporated into your diet as snacks, salad toppings, butters, or mixed into recipes.

In This Article

Top Contenders: A Closer Look at High-Protein Nuts

While almost all nuts offer some amount of protein, a few varieties stand out for their exceptional protein density and other nutritional advantages. A handful of these can make a significant contribution to your daily protein intake, especially for those following a plant-based diet.

Peanuts

Often mistaken for a true nut, the peanut is a legume that grows underground but is nutritionally similar to tree nuts. It consistently ranks at the top for protein content, with about 7–9.5 grams per 1-ounce serving, depending on the preparation. Beyond protein, peanuts are rich in monounsaturated and polyunsaturated fats, fiber, and important micronutrients like vitamin E, niacin, and thiamine, which support bone health and energy conversion. They are also a more affordable protein source compared to many tree nuts, making them an accessible option for many.

Almonds

Almonds are a nutritional powerhouse, providing approximately 6–7 grams of protein per ounce. They are an excellent source of vitamin E and antioxidants, which help protect against cell damage. The skin of the almond is particularly high in antioxidants, so consuming them with the skin offers maximum benefits. Almonds are also packed with fiber, magnesium, and calcium, supporting heart health and strong bones. Their versatility makes them perfect for snacking, baking, or adding to cereals and salads.

Pistachios

Pistachios offer a unique nutritional profile, delivering around 6 grams of protein per ounce. Notably, pistachios are considered a complete protein source, meaning they contain all nine essential amino acids necessary for the body's functions. They are also a great source of blood-pressure-regulating potassium, immune-supporting vitamin B6, and antioxidants like lutein and zeaxanthin, which promote eye health. The act of shelling pistachios can also slow down your eating, aiding in portion control.

Other Protein-Rich Nuts and Seeds

While peanuts, almonds, and pistachios often steal the spotlight, several other nuts and seeds also offer a good protein punch.

  • Cashews: These buttery nuts provide about 4–5 grams of protein per ounce, along with significant amounts of copper and magnesium, which support immunity and bone health.
  • Walnuts: Known for their omega-3 fatty acid content, walnuts also contain around 4–5 grams of protein per ounce. The antioxidants in walnuts can help combat inflammation and oxidative stress.
  • Brazil Nuts: While lower in protein (around 4 grams per ounce), Brazil nuts are an exceptional source of selenium. Just one nut can meet the daily selenium requirement, a mineral crucial for thyroid health.
  • Pine Nuts: Often used in pesto, these nuts contain about 4–4.5 grams of protein per quarter-cup serving. They are also a source of monounsaturated fats that may help support heart health.

Comparison of High-Protein Nuts

Nut (1 ounce serving) Protein (grams) Fiber (grams) Key Nutrients
Peanuts ~7.3g ~2g Vitamin E, Biotin, Niacin
Almonds ~6.0g ~3.5g Vitamin E, Calcium, Magnesium
Pistachios ~5.7g ~3g Potassium, Vitamin B6, Antioxidants
Cashews ~5.1g ~1g Copper, Magnesium, Zinc
Walnuts ~4.3g ~1.7g Omega-3s, Antioxidants
Brazil Nuts ~4.0g ~1.6g Selenium

Note: Values are approximate and may vary based on source and preparation.

Incorporating Protein-Rich Nuts into Your Diet

There are numerous ways to add these nutritional powerhouses to your meals and snacks.

  • Snack on them: A handful of dry-roasted almonds or pistachios is a convenient and satisfying snack that provides lasting energy.
  • Add to meals: Sprinkle chopped walnuts or cashews onto salads, stir-fries, and grain bowls for added crunch and protein.
  • Make your own butter: Blend peanuts or almonds into a homemade nut butter, free from added sugars and oils, for spreading on toast or pairing with fruit.
  • Boost smoothies and baking: Incorporate nut butter or finely ground almonds into smoothies and baked goods for extra protein and texture.
  • Create a trail mix: Combine your favorite high-protein nuts with dried fruit and dark chocolate chunks for a custom, nutrient-dense mix.

Conclusion: Making the Right Nut Choice for Protein

While peanuts technically lead the pack in terms of raw protein per ounce, the best nut for protein ultimately depends on your overall dietary needs and health goals. For a complete protein source, pistachios are an excellent choice. If you prioritize heart health and antioxidants, almonds and walnuts are strong contenders. For a budget-friendly option that doesn't skimp on protein, peanuts are hard to beat. Incorporating a variety of these high-protein nuts into your diet is the most effective strategy to gain a range of nutritional benefits beyond just protein content.

For more detailed nutritional information on these and other nuts and seeds, consult the U.S. Department of Agriculture's FoodData Central database.

Frequently Asked Questions

Among commonly consumed nuts, peanuts (a legume) contain the highest protein content, with over 7 grams per 1-ounce serving.

While most nuts are considered incomplete proteins, pistachios are a notable exception, as they contain all nine essential amino acids needed for a complete protein profile.

Nuts are a great way to boost your protein intake but are not sufficient as a sole source. They should be consumed as part of a varied diet that includes other protein-rich foods like legumes, eggs, or poultry.

The protein content remains largely the same between raw and roasted nuts. The primary nutritional difference lies in the potential loss of certain heat-sensitive vitamins and the use of added oils or salt in some roasted varieties.

Beyond protein, these nuts provide healthy fats, fiber, vitamins, and minerals that support heart health, aid in digestion, and offer antioxidant benefits.

The combination of protein, fiber, and healthy fats in nuts helps you feel full and satisfied for longer periods, which can help control appetite and prevent overeating.

A standard 1-ounce serving, which is roughly a small handful, can contain between 4 and 7 grams of protein, depending on the nut type.

References

  1. 1
  2. 2
  3. 3
  4. 4
  5. 5

Medical Disclaimer

This content is for informational purposes only and should not replace professional medical advice.